Fortnite: How to Outlast Opponents for Season 7, Week 10 Challenge

Fortnite's Epic and Legendary quests are great methods for players to earn a ton of extra XP, and they also serve as a nice change in pace to the battle royale gameplay. Instead of just shooting down opponents and attempting to win a victory royale, players can go out and glide through rings as Clark Kent or even dance on an abductor. However, some of these quests can be more confusing and less straightforward than others, like having to outlast opponents, for example. Some might think that players will just need to win a match a few times, but that's not entirely the case.

To outlast opponents in Fortnite, players will need to simply survive until they are one of the last players standing. To complete the Fortnite quest, gamers will need to outlast a total of 200 opponents, and there's an easy method to get it done fast and easy in as little as three matches.

Players can complete this quest by starting a match and then just hiding out until most of the players are dead. Once about 75% of the opponents are gone, Fortnite players should build a high ramp with resources and then jump off it to kill themselves. Players can also just jump from any high surface, and it should take them out. Once they're dead, they should see the number beside the quest title go up a bit.

Fortnite players will not have to get first place in a match for this to work. They'll earn points towards quest completion as long as they outlast at least one player before dying. For example, if a player ends up in 30th place, they should rack up around 70 points towards the quest since they outlasted 70 other players.

Once players outlast 200 opponents, the quest will be done, and they will earn a whopping 30K XP. From here, players can continue to work on any other quests that they might have on the docket.
